如何检测导致“最后”cmd 输出中的条目的原因?

如何检测导致“最后”cmd 输出中的条目的原因?
last
...
date      {                                 Sun Mar 31 12:00
date      |                                 Sun Mar 31 12:00
date      {                                 Sun Mar 31 00:00
date      |                                 Sun Mar 31 00:00
...

为什么最后的命令输出中有 ex: "{" ?某种脚本可以做到这一点? (在 OpenBSD 5.1 上)

答案1

您看到的行表明系统时间已自动更新。 '|'字符表示更改之前的时间,“{”字符表示新时间。

来源:man utmp (5)

答案2

您可以尝试使用strace last来找出到底是什么使输出包含{|字符。

相关内容